Hi BTallent & welcome
I prefer to use zero drops of menthol, because I can't stand menthol. However to answer your question I'd suggest you go to a site called E Liquid Recipes and start an account (it costs nothing unless you are feeling generous). Do a look up on their recipe list for menthol and see how much is being suggested in other people's recipes. Then go to their flavor list and look up the actual menthol flavor you have and click on it. The data page on that flavor will have Notes that other folks have written with their preferred single flavor usage %. Of course the site is also useful for new recipes, modding and saving recipes, and figuring out what flavors to buy.
